     17 package com.android.systemui.statusbar.phone;
     18 
     19 import android.animation.LayoutTransition;
     20 import android.content.Context;
     21 import android.content.res.Resources;
     22 import android.util.AttributeSet;
     23 import android.view.View;
     24 import android.view.ViewGroup;
     25 import android.widget.FrameLayout;
     26 
     27 import com.android.systemui.R;
     28 
     29 /**
     30  *
     31  */
     32 class QuickSettingsContainerView extends FrameLayout {
     33 
     34     // The number of columns in the QuickSettings grid
     35     private int mNumColumns;
     36 
     37     // The gap between tiles in the QuickSettings grid
     38     private float mCellGap;
     39 
     40     public QuickSettingsContainerView(Context context, AttributeSet attrs) {
     41         super(context, attrs);
     42 
     43         updateResources();
     44     }
     45 
     46     @Override
     47     protected void onFinishInflate() {
     48         super.onFinishInflate();
     49 
     50         // TODO: Setup the layout transitions
     51         LayoutTransition transitions = getLayoutTransition();
     52     }
     53 
     54     void updateResources() {
     55         Resources r = getContext().getResources();
     56         mCellGap = r.getDimension(R.dimen.quick_settings_cell_gap);
     57         mNumColumns = r.getInteger(R.integer.quick_settings_num_columns);
     58         requestLayout();
     59     }
     60 
     61     @Override
     62     protected void onMeasure(int widthMeasureSpec, int heightMeasureSpec) {
     63         // Calculate the cell width dynamically
     64         int width = MeasureSpec.getSize(widthMeasureSpec);
     65         int height = MeasureSpec.getSize(heightMeasureSpec);
     66         int availableWidth = (int) (width - getPaddingLeft() - getPaddingRight() -
     67                 (mNumColumns - 1) * mCellGap);
     68         float cellWidth = (float) Math.ceil(((float) availableWidth) / mNumColumns);
     69 
     70         // Update each of the children's widths accordingly to the cell width
     71         final int N = getChildCount();
     72         int cellHeight = 0;
     73         int cursor = 0;
     74         for (int i = 0; i < N; ++i) {
     75             // Update the child's width
     76             QuickSettingsTileView v = (QuickSettingsTileView) getChildAt(i);
     77             if (v.getVisibility() != View.GONE) {
     78                 ViewGroup.MarginLayoutParams lp = (ViewGroup.MarginLayoutParams) v.getLayoutParams();
     79                 int colSpan = v.getColumnSpan();
     80                 lp.width = (int) ((colSpan * cellWidth) + (colSpan - 1) * mCellGap);
     81 
     82                 // Measure the child
     83                 int newWidthSpec = MeasureSpec.makeMeasureSpec(lp.width, MeasureSpec.EXACTLY);
     84                 int newHeightSpec = MeasureSpec.makeMeasureSpec(lp.height, MeasureSpec.EXACTLY);
     85                 v.measure(newWidthSpec, newHeightSpec);
     86 
     87                 // Save the cell height
     88                 if (cellHeight <= 0) {
     89                     cellHeight = v.getMeasuredHeight();
     90                 }
     91                 cursor += colSpan;
     92             }
     93         }
     94 
     95         // Set the measured dimensions.  We always fill the tray width, but wrap to the height of
     96         // all the tiles.
     97         int numRows = (int) Math.ceil((float) cursor / mNumColumns);
     98         int newHeight = (int) ((numRows * cellHeight) + ((numRows - 1) * mCellGap)) +
     99                 getPaddingTop() + getPaddingBottom();
    100         setMeasuredDimension(width, newHeight);
    101     }
    102 
    103     @Override
    104     protected void onLayout(boolean changed, int left, int top, int right, int bottom) {
    105         final int N = getChildCount();
    106         final boolean isLayoutRtl = isLayoutRtl();
    107         final int width = getWidth();
    108 
    109         int x = getPaddingStart();
    110         int y = getPaddingTop();
    111         int cursor = 0;
    112 
    113         for (int i = 0; i < N; ++i) {
    114             QuickSettingsTileView child = (QuickSettingsTileView) getChildAt(i);
    115             ViewGroup.LayoutParams lp = child.getLayoutParams();
    116             if (child.getVisibility() != GONE) {
    117                 final int col = cursor % mNumColumns;
    118                 final int colSpan = child.getColumnSpan();
    119 
    120                 final int childWidth = lp.width;
    121                 final int childHeight = lp.height;
    122 
    123                 int row = (int) (cursor / mNumColumns);
    124 
    125                 // Push the item to the next row if it can't fit on this one
    126                 if ((col + colSpan) > mNumColumns) {
    127                     x = getPaddingStart();
    128                     y += childHeight + mCellGap;
    129                     row++;
    130                 }
    131 
    132                 final int childLeft = (isLayoutRtl) ? width - x - childWidth : x;
    133                 final int childRight = childLeft + childWidth;
    134 
    135                 final int childTop = y;
    136                 final int childBottom = childTop + childHeight;
    137 
    138                 // Layout the container
    139                 child.layout(childLeft, childTop, childRight, childBottom);
    140 
    141                 // Offset the position by the cell gap or reset the position and cursor when we
    142                 // reach the end of the row
    143                 cursor += child.getColumnSpan();
    144                 if (cursor < (((row + 1) * mNumColumns))) {
    145                     x += childWidth + mCellGap;
    146                 } else {
    147                     x = getPaddingStart();
    148                     y += childHeight + mCellGap;
    149                 }
    150             }
    151         }
    152     }
    153 }
